A 62 kg wake boarder is being pulled by a boat with a force of 124 N. What is the acceleration of the wake boarder?

Answers

Answer: 2m/s

Explanation:

The acceleration of the wake boarder is equal to 2 m/s².

What is acceleration?

Acceleration of a body can be described as the change in velocity of a body with respect to time. The acceleration is a vector parameter posses both magnitude and direction. Acceleration is described as as the second derivative of position w.r.t. time and the first derivative of the velocity of an object w.r.t. time.

According to Newton's 2nd law of motion, the force (F) acting is equal to the product of the mass and acceleration (a).

F = ma

or,   a = F/m

Therefore, acceleration (a) is inversely proportional to the mass (m).

Given, the force with which the boat pulled wake boarder, F = 124 N

The mass of the wake boarder = 62 Kg

The acceleration of the wake boarder, a = 124/62 = 2 m/s²

Therefore, the acceleration of the wake boarder is 2 m/s².

1. LAW OF SUPERPOSITION: When observing rock layers, the oldest rocks/fossils can be found at the ______________, while the youngest can be found at the _______________.
a. middle, bottom
b. left, right
c. bottom, top
d. top, bottom

2. Two rock layers contain fossils of similar organisms. What is likely true of these rock layers?
a. They were from different environments.
b. They had advantageous traits.
c. They had analogous structures.
d. They were from the same time period.
ps this is science

Answers

Answer:

Q1. Young rocks are found on top, and old layer are found on the bottom.

Q2. Layers of sedimentary rock. Fossil layers are fossils that formed in sedimentary rock. When, over a long time, layers and layers of sediments get deposited on top of each other, the weight of the top layers presses down on the bottom layers, forming them into rock called sedimentary rock

Explanation:

Sedimentary rocks are deposited one on top of another. Therefore, the youngest layers are found at the top, and the oldest layers are found at the bottom of the sequence.

Steno proposed that if a rock contained the fossils of marine animals, the rock formed from sediments that were deposited on the seafloor. ... (c) Superposition: Sedimentary rocks are deposited one on top of another. The youngest layers are found at the top of the sequence, and the oldest layers are found at the bottom
